Hello all.

Getting restarted into collecting after losing my collection over 15 years ago. Have been a single parent of three since then, so haven't had the time or resources to get back into the hobby until recently. Down to the last kid still at home, so finally finding some free time.

Having been with Scouts as a youth and adult (Cubmaster, Boy Scout Committee and Roundtable, Girl Scout Assistant Leader, and now a Venture Adviser), Scouting stamps were one of my primary interests. I have started expanding that to include covers and Post Cards.

Starting again on some of the old milestones: stamp of each country (200+ so far), then on to a set of each country. Haven't started focusing in on a specific country yet, but those of Australia and Japan have always attracted me.

Looking forward to chatting with everyone and will probably have plenty of questions as I get back into the hobby.
